UK Consumer Spending on Card Increases 102%
The Index Today
The office of National Statistics ONS stated on Thursday that British consumer spending through credit cards has increased in the first week of October to 102% as compared to the spending levels recorded in February last year.
According to ONS reports, number of online job advertisements remained at the same level as last weeks, around 40% over pre-pandemic levels. Highest gains of 380% were recorded in logistics, warehouse jobs and transport.
